Former Chelsea striker Billy Dodds expects Scottish giants Rangers to cash in on Cyriel Dessers at the end of the season.
The Nigerian forward had been linked with a move away from Ibrox in the January transfer window, but ultimately remained with the club.
Dessers' agent had revealed that 10 teams had expressed interest in signing the 30-year-old, but Rangers opted to keep him until the end of the campaign.
The decision was likely influenced by the recent struggles of other strikers at the club, including Hamza Igamane and Danilo, who has been dealing with fitness issues.
Billy Dodds believes that Dessers' situation is worth monitoring, given the club's financial situation.
Dodds believes that Rangers could still sell Dessers for a decent fee, given that the Nigerian international is now in top form and has regained his place in the starting lineup.
"I think he's one Rangers player, because you always talk about the finances at the club, who would command a fair fee," said the former Dundee caretaker boss on the Go Radio Football Show as quoted by Ibrox News.
"I think Rangers were probably sussing out the market, and I know his agent was as well. That's why the 10 teams came up."
Despite a poor start to the season, the Nigerian international's form has been a welcome boost to Rangers, who have been struggling to find consistency in their attacking play.
Rangers' decision to keep Dessers until the end of the campaign could prove to be a shrewd move, as the striker has returned to form in recent matches.
Dessers' confidence and performances have been impressive, and he will be a key player for Rangers in the coming months.
